New Markets Tax Credit Program

The New Markets Tax Credit (NMTC) Program was designed to leverage capital from investors to spur economic development in urban and rural low-income communities. Within the Treasury Department, the Community Development Financial Institutions Fund (CDFI Fund) and the Internal Revenue Service (through Section 45D of the Internal Revenue Code) jointly administer the program. The NMTC program has become an important tool for promoting economic development and community revitalization strategies in low-income markets.

New Markets Tax Credits: Unlocking Investment Potential, (PDF) Community Developments Insights Report, February 2007. This publication examines the primary risks, benefits, and regulatory considerations associated with New Market Tax Credits (NMTCs). The report also discusses the ways in which bank investors have structured and managed these credits effectively. Banks have been active participants in the NMTC program because of the ability to generate competitive economic returns, and the opportunities they present for positive CRA consideration.

Community Development Financial Institutions (CDFI) Fund - The Treasury Department's CDFI Fund, established by the Riegle Community Development and Regulatory Improvement Act of 1994, expands the capacity of financial institutions to provide credit, capital, and financial services to underserved populations and communities in the United States. The CDFI Fund is the administrator of the NMTC program.  The New Markets Tax Credit (NMTC) Program provides information on the program, including eligibility and application materials.
